Rob Brook-Amazon Review
With a feeling for guitar "pure and untainted" as Fleetwood Mac's Peter Green was to later observe, 16-year old Kossoff reveals precocious musicianship in 1967 London rehearsals for this Chicago-based blues band, from which this 2-CD set is culled. A musical metaphor for Virginia Woolf's stream of consciousness, his playing is as fluid and expressive as Green or Clapton's, and while these recordings, culled from over six hours of tapes, are often raw, muddy listening, they still compel. Koss, Derek and Stuart Brookes (later to form cult act Leaf Hound) and jazz drummer Frank Perry run through blues standards including `Bad Blood', `Rock Me Baby and `Shake Your Moneymaker' with occasionally weary determination. But when it starts muddling, Kossoff always regains the narrative thread and runs with it. Future band-mate, Free vocalist Paul Rodgers does a brief turn on `I'm Ready', but doesn't sound it. A generous booklet with rare photographs and first-hand experience notes reference with care and detail what must have been special to witness. Fame with Free beckoned a year later, but Kossoff never got over the band's break-up and died in 1976 of heart failure brought on by depression and drug abuse, making this tinderbox moment the more poignant and important to share now.

08. Paul's Blues Recorded by Frank E. Perry II at rehearsals in Tottenham Court Road, London, 1967.
- Paul Tiller: vocals / harmonica
- Paul Kossoff: lead guitar
- Derek Brooks: rhythm guitar
- Stuart Brooks: bass guitar
- Frank Perry: drums
+ Paul Rogers (vocals) on I'm Ready
